Kifwebe Mask - Songye - DR Congo (Zaire) - African Masks
The Bifwebe masks (kifwebe in the singular) are part of the ceremonial objects of the society of the same name (bwadi ka kifwebe) which still today plays a prestigious role among the eastern Songye.

The members of this society are the basha masende, custodians of the knowledge necessary to interact with the gods.
The bifwebe masks are worn with a long costume and a long beard made of plant fiber, during the most important ceremonies.

The female mask, unlike the male one, the kilume (plural bilume), lacks a crest at the top of the head and features fine white-incised lines on the face.
